Topic : Installations list is incorrect


Posted By: DigitalEssence on April 20, 2017, 9:04 am
Hi,

I've just installed the program and when I search for installations the information it is providing is incorrect.

For example it is showing some that no longer exist and even the subdomain and directory were removed a long time ago.

Others it is showing two reports for the same incorrect domain that is no longer present and in others it is showing an out of date WP install which is in fact up to date.

Also. I have a lot of other installations for other users on the server. Is there a way to bulk import them into the application?

Posted By: priya_mittal on April 20, 2017, 9:36 am | Post: 1
Hi,

>>For example it is showing some that no longer exist and even the subdomain and directory were removed a long time ago.
Did you delete or make some changes manually? The issue mostly occur when the changes are done manually but not updated in Softaculous records.

>>Others it is showing two reports for the same incorrect domain that is no longer present and in others it is showing an out of date WP install which is in fact up to date.
WP has an auto upgrade feature which upgrades itself whenever the installation is visited. In this case, it is important to update the same in Softaculous.

Although we have added two settings in Softaculous Admin Panel for the above two issues.
1. Softaculous Admin Panel -> General Settings -> Sync installations list with Softaculous Records
2. Softaculous Admin Panel -> General Settings -> Detect and update actual version of installations

Enable both the above settings and execute Softaculous cron as root based on your control panel from the following link:
https://www.softaculous.com/docs/Immediate_Synchronize_with_Softaculous_Servers

Both the above issues must be resolved.

>>Also. I have a lot of other installations for other users on the server. Is there a way to bulk import them into the application?
You can follow our guide here for this:
https://www.softaculous.com/docs/Admin_Import_Utility

Posted By: Brijesh on April 22, 2017, 7:24 am | Post: 3
Hi,

>> The subdomains in question were deleted well over a year ago. I only installed softaculous last night.

Did you install Softaculous previously ? Or maybe you migrated the data from another server where Softaculous was installed ?

The installation data is stored at the following path :
/home/USERNAME/.softaculous/installations.php

Softaculous reads the data from this file and if this file already existed from previous Softaculous installation Softaculous will list those installations as well.

>> The WordPress installation in question was updated prior to me installing Softaculous.

This could be the same case as above.
